Jill Biden showcased her commitment to family by attending her stepson Hunter Biden’s gun trial in Wilmington last week, sitting prominently in the front row in colorful outfits. Her powerful presence in the courtroom, marked by stilettos and bold power suits, ensured no one, especially the jury, could overlook her.

To demonstrate her dedication to Hunter, when she had to accompany the president on an official visit to France for D-Day commemorations during the trial, Dr. Jill arranged for a taxpayer-funded solo round trip back to the court from Paris with her aide Anthony Bernal, emphasizing her support for Hunter.

However, according to Lunden Roberts, who had to file a paternity suit against Hunter and obtain a court-ordered DNA test for their daughter, the first lady has treated the president’s seventh grandchild unkindly and callously.

Roberts, in her book “Out of the Shadows,” reveals that neither Jill nor Joe nor Hunter Biden have ever met Navy, their 5-year-old granddaughter. Describing her tumultuous relationship with Hunter in 2018, Roberts recounts the challenges of dealing with his addiction issues, court battles, and neglect towards Navy.

Despite a reduction in child support payments, Roberts managed to secure a promise from Hunter to establish a relationship with Navy through Zoom calls. It wasn’t until later, in a statement to People magazine, that Joe and Jill acknowledged Navy as their grandchild.

“Our son Hunter and Navy’s mother, Lunden, are working together to foster a relationship that is in the best interests of their daughter,” said Joe in a statement. However, Navy’s exclusion from the family Christmas display and other instances of neglect highlight the first family’s lack of acknowledgment.

In a podcast interview, Roberts expressed her disappointment at the exclusion of Navy and the hurt caused by the first family’s actions. Despite Hunter’s initial denial of Navy’s existence, Roberts hopes for a positive change in their relationship.

Roberts’s unwavering devotion to her daughter and willingness to forgive Hunter show her strength. However, her reluctance to forgive the Biden matriarch suggests deeper wounds that may take time to heal.
